Once We Moved Like the Wind, Concerto (2 Solo Guitars & Guitar Orchestra, 2014)
As performed by the Arizona Guitar Orchestra ›
Once We Moved Like the Wind is an homage to legendary Apache medicine man and warrior Geronimo. It was inspired in part by Brad’s experience building guitar programs in schools on the San Carlos Apache reservation in Arizona and playing concerts there with his friend and teacher Carlos Bonell who also premiered this piece with Brad in 2014. The title of the work is a quote from Geronimo and the title for the first movement was inspired by his last words: “I should have never surrendered. I should have fought until I was the last man alive”. The three movements use extended techniques. prepared guitars, stomping and tuning alterations to create an exciting and expressive range of sounds and colors. The 16-minute long work comes with well-conceived parts and a conductor’s score.
